GN-z11 in Context: Possible Signatures of Globular Cluster Precursors at Redshift 10
Charlot, Stéphane; James, Bethan L.; Mingozzi, Matilde +5 more
The first JWST spectroscopy of the luminous galaxy GN-z11 simultaneously established its redshift at z = 10.6 and revealed a rest-ultraviolet spectrum dominated by signatures of highly ionized nitrogen, which has so far defied clear interpretation. First Detection of an Overmassive Black Hole Galaxy UHZ1: Evidence for Heavy Black Hole Seed Formation from Direct Collapse
Goulding, Andy D.; Natarajan, Priyamvada; Bogdán, Ákos +3 more
The recent Chandra-JWST discovery of a quasar in the z ≈ 10.1 galaxy UHZ1 reveals that accreting supermassive black holes were already in place 470 million years after the Big Bang. The Radius of the High-mass Pulsar PSR J0740+6620 with 3.6 yr of NICER Data
Chakrabarty, Deepto; Bogdanov, Slavko; Salmi, Tuomo +14 more
We report an updated analysis of the radius, mass, and heated surface regions of the massive pulsar PSR J0740+6620 using Neutron Star Interior Composition Explorer (NICER) data from 2018 September 21 to 2022 April 21, a substantial increase in data set size compared to previous analyses. The Next Generation Deep Extragalactic Exploratory Public (NGDEEP) Survey
Papovich, Casey; Finkelstein, Steven L.; Pérez-González, Pablo G. +45 more
We present the Next Generation Deep Extragalactic Exploratory Public (NGDEEP) Survey, a deep slitless spectroscopic and imaging Cycle 1 JWST treasury survey designed to constrain feedback mechanisms in low-mass galaxies across cosmic time. RUBIES: Evolved Stellar Populations with Extended Formation Histories at z ∼ 7–8 in Candidate Massive Galaxies Identified with JWST/NIRSpec
Cleri, Nikko J.; Labbé, Ivo; van Dokkum, Pieter +17 more
The identification of red, apparently massive galaxies at z > 7 in early James Webb Space Telescope (JWST) photometry suggests a strongly accelerated time line compared to standard models of galaxy growth.
